Efficacy and safety of the combination of encorafenib/cetuximab with or without binimetinib in patients with BRAF V600E-mutated metastatic colorectal cancer: an AGEO real-world multicenter study

Abstract
Background
The combination of encorafenib with cetuximab has become the standard of care in patients with BRAF V600E-mutated metastatic colorectal cancer (mCRC) after a prior systemic therapy. This study aims to describe the efficacy and safety of encorafenib/cetuximab +/− binimetinib in patients with BRAF V600E-mutated mCRC in a real-world setting.
Patients and methods
This retrospective study included patients with BRAF V600E-mutated mCRC who received this combination from January 2020 to June 2022 in 30 centers.
Results
A total of 201 patients were included, with 55% of women, a median age of 62 years, and an Eastern Cooperative Oncology Group performance status (ECOG-PS) >1 in 20% of cases. The main tumor characteristics were 60% of right-sided primary tumor, 11% of microsatellite instability/mismatch repair deficient phenotype, and liver and peritoneum being the two main metastatic sites (57% and 51%). Encorafenib/cetuximab +/− binimetinib was prescribed in the first, second, third, and beyond third line in 4%, 56%, 29%, and 11%, respectively, of cases, with the encorafenib/cetuximab/binimetinib combination for 21 patients (10%). With encorafenib/cetuximab treatment, 21% of patients experienced grade ≥3 adverse events (AEs), with each type of grade ≥3 AE observed in <5% of patients. The objective response rate was 32.2% and the disease control rate (DCR) was 71.2%. The median progression-free survival (PFS) was 4.5 months [95% confidence interval (CI) 3.9-5.4 months] and the median overall survival (OS) was 9.2 months (95% CI 7.8-10.8 months). In multivariable analysis, factors associated with a shorter PFS were synchronous metastases [hazard ratio (HR) 1.66, P = 0.04] and ECOG-PS >1 (HR 1.88, P = 0.007), and those associated with a shorter OS were the same factors (HR 1.71, P = 0.03 and HR 2.36, P < 0.001, respectively) in addition to treatment beyond the second line (HR 1.74, P = 0.003) and high carcinoembryonic antigen level (HR 1.72, P = 0.003).
Conclusion
This real-world study showed that in patients with BRAF V600E-mutated mCRC treated with encorafenib/cetuximab +/− binimetinib, efficacy and safety data confirm those reported in the BEACON registration trial. The main poor prognostic factors for this treatment are synchronous metastases and ECOG-PS >1.
